I deleted those files a long time ago and nothing ill has come of it. Also, programs are not guaranteed that the contents of the Temp folder with remain from session to session, so well-behaved programs, of which Windows Installer is one, only store files in there for one run; they do not expect them to be there next time. -- Chris Quoting when replying to this message is good for your karma.
